Rashtriya Swayamsevak Sangh (RSS) Sah Sarkaryavahs Dattatreya Hosabale recently said the linkage between inflation and food prices needs to be given serious thought and stressed that people want food, clothing and shelter to be affordable as they are basic requirements. He also credited all governments till date for making India self-reliant in agriculture. He underlined that though the essentials have to be affordable for everyone, farmers should not have to bear the brunt of it.

Speaking at an RSS event — “International Conference on Harnessing Indian Agriculture for Domestic and Global Prosperity” — in Delhi, Hosabale said: “The link between inflation and food prices needs to be pondered over. India has not only become self-reliant in grains but can also send to other countries and for that credit goes to all governments till date, scientists and farmers”. Hosabale’s statement assumes significance as the annual inflation rate in India stood at 7.01 per cent in June, according to government data. Hosabale also said,’ students of agriculture must also learn about India’s ancient knowledge systems that had the best traditional farming practices’.
